SC issues notice to Jayalalithaa

NewsGram Desk

New Delhi: The Supreme Court on Monday issued notice to Tamil Nadu Chief Minister J. Jayalalithaa on a petition by the Karnataka government challenging the state high court verdict acquitting her and three others in a disproportionate assets case.

An apex court bench headed by Justice P.C Ghose also issued notice returnable in eight weeks on the petition by DMK leader K. Anbazhagan and BJP leader Subramanian Swamy, both challenging Karnataka High Court verdict acquitting Jayalalithaa.
